The Minnesota and other Midwest manufacturing sector grew robustly in February despite West Coast shipping woes that slammed much of the country, according to two widely watched economic reports released Monday.
While U.S. factory gains slowed in February, Midwest producers reported increases in factory sales and delivery speeds, while benefiting from decreases in raw material prices for the month.
